Phage uncharacterized protein (Phage_XkdX); This entry identifies a family of small (about 50 amino acid) phage proteins, found in at least 12 different phage and prophage regions of Gram-positive bacteria. In a number of these phage, the gene for this protein is found near the holin and endolysin genes.
